Full Description

During an archaeological investigation ahead of the development of land to the north of Cliffsend Road, Cliffsend a few features were identified as being of a Medieval date. These included a quarry and a building, both of which were positioned in the south western corner of the excavated area.

Only the south-easter part of the large quarry pit was recorded, the rest of the feature lay beyond the limit of the excavations. The pit measured at least c 10m by 7m and was 0.6m deep. After the silt clay natural had been quarried, the feature was left to silt up gradually and contained only a few finds. The building was dug through the edge of the infilled quarry and so can be said to have been clearly later than the quarry. The sub-rectangular structure was c 4.9m by 3.15m and the sunken element that measured c 0.7m deep with steep stepped sides and a flat base. The step in the sides could have feasibly supported form of timber suspended floor. Unlike the earlier buildings discovered at this site, this building did not contain an oven and therefore clearly served a different function. (information summarised from source)
